PubMed Central is a repository of open access full-text scholarly articles in biomedical and life sciences journals, developed by the National Center for Biotechnology Information (NCBI). It is distinct from PubMed, which is a searchable database of citations and abstracts, and has over 5.2 million articles as of December 2018.

Medical Subject Headings (MeSH) is a controlled vocabulary for indexing life sciences articles and books. It is used by MEDLINE/PubMed, ClinicalTrials.gov and other databases.
